ABWA Niagara: Serving Niagara's Businesswomen

The ABWA Niagara Falls Charter Chapter serves the Niagara Falls, NY region as the local chapter of the nationwide American Business Women’s Association. In September, we will celebrate our 55th anniversary! Our chapter activities include monthly dinners, professional development, and special events including our popular annual auction luncheon. Learn more about our Mission and Chapter.

Our Niagara Falls chapter supports women in business who live or work in the greater Niagara Falls, NY area, including the city of Niagara Falls, North Tonawanda, Lewiston, Youngstown, Grand Island, and Wheatfield. Our chapter members have dedicated their time to raise funds to educate and create opportunities for our members, as well as to support our community.
